Latest Patents
Hooykaas holds a patent titled "Methods for transfecting plants and for reducing random integration events." This patent provides innovative methods for transfecting plants and expressing RNA or polypeptide molecules within them. Specifically, it addresses the transfection of plants with reduced POLQ expression and/or activity to minimize random integration events. The patent also includes details about transfected plants and their progeny produced through these methods. He has 1 patent to his name.
